Local SEO vs. Proximity SEO: Why the Distinction Changes Everything
Most marketers conflate ‘local SEO’ with ‘proximity SEO’. They’re fundamentally different disciplines—like weather forecasting versus climate modeling. Local SEO optimizes for *category + city* (‘hotel in Seattle’). Proximity SEO optimizes for *real-time intent + micro-location + contextual need*. Confusing them leads to wasted effort and missed opportunities.
Local SEO: Static, City-Centric, and Category-Driven
Local SEO focuses on foundational elements: GBP optimization, NAP (Name, Address, Phone) consistency across 50+ directories, city-specific landing pages, and citation building. It’s essential—but it’s table stakes. A hotel ranked #1 for ‘hotel in Seattle’ may not appear for hotel nearby if its GBP lacks real-time inventory, has outdated photos, or fails to tag nearby landmarks. Local SEO builds visibility; proximity SEO builds *relevance at the moment of need*.
Proximity SEO: Dynamic, Intent-Driven, and Real-Time
Proximity SEO operates on live data layers: GPS-triggered content, real-time occupancy feeds, voice-optimized Q&A, and behavioral velocity tracking. It treats ‘nearby’ as a variable—not a fixed radius. For example, a hotel near an airport may dynamically serve ‘hotel nearby’ content emphasizing ’24/7 shuttle’ during 3 a.m. searches, but switch to ‘quiet courtyard rooms’ for 10 a.m. searches. As Search Engine Journal’s 2024 Proximity SEO Deep Dive states: ‘Proximity SEO isn’t about being *in* a location—it’s about proving you’re the *right* location, *right now*, for *this* user’s unspoken need.’

Do I need a separate website page for every nearby landmark?
No—but you *do* need dynamic proximity content hubs. Instead of static pages like ‘hotel-near-pike-place-market’, build a single, API-powered page (e.g., ‘/nearby’) that auto-generates walking guides, real-time wait times, and landmark-specific tips based on the user’s live location and search context. This is more scalable, SEO-friendly, and user-relevant.
